A most unusual romance.
What will a girl do to survive?SofÃa is fourteen years old. Just fourteen years old. And she suffers from a terrible illness, which will mean that she will never become fifteen. Until one day she meets a strange old man, a lonely and grumpy millionaire who will propose a solution to save her life: She will have to marry him until she turns eighteen. For a frightened girl, marriage can be just as scary as death.
SofÃa will have to decide for herself what to do in the face of the diabolical dilemma that has been presented to her. Should she give in to his blackmail or not? Is the man who wants her for himself an angel or a demon? The difference between one and the other is not always clear, and her future husband has very dark shadows in his life. But if she wants to survive, she will have to unite her destiny with him...
A moving love storyThis beautiful romantic novel is about human nature, about good and evil, about fear and love, about how two human beings can be united and separated by forces that they do not control and yet can still decide their own destiny.
